Drop to 415 V and it still holds 121 kA; at 440 V it's 75.6 kA; at 500 V and 690 V it holds 17 kA. That curve means the breaker clears fast enough to protect downstream gear across a wide voltage range without cascading failure — useful when the same panel feeds both 480 V and 240 V loads through separate transformers. The 20 A rating holds flat from 40 °C through 55 °C, then derates to 19 A at 60–70 °C — no surprise for a thermal-magnetic MCCB, but worth noting if the breaker lives in a hot enclosure next to a transformer or drive. ## Auxiliary and shunt trip fit The shunt trip lets a remote signal — from an E-stop, fire alarm relay, or PLC output — open the breaker electrically without a person at the handle. No undervoltage release on this code; if UVR is required, that's a different suffix. The auxiliary switches are designated HQ type — that's Siemens' notation for early-make / late-break contacts used in signaling circuits. They mount on the left side of the breaker and are wired through the terminal cover. The shunt trip coil draws from the control voltage; verify polarity and voltage rating against the panel's control transformer before wiring. Maximum power loss is 12 W at rated load. That's moderate for a 20 A MCCB; in a dense panel with multiple breakers side-by-side, account for the cumulative heat in the enclosure sizing calculation.","metaTitle":"Siemens 3VA1120-5EF32-0HC0 SENTRON MCCB, 20A 3P, 187kA at 24","metaDescription":"Siemens SENTRON 3VA1120-5EF32-0HC0 molded case circuit breaker, 20A rated, 3-pole, 187kA breaking capacity at 240V AC.
